McGorry spoke to E! Online recently about the second season of Orange is the New Black, and while he did not say much, he did tease that Bennett will not have an easy season.

Bennett's love affair with prisoner Daya (Dascha Polanco) in season 1 resulted in a pregnancy, which will only lead to more complications in season 2.

"You can't exactly have candlelight dinners," McGorry said. "You'll get to see Bennett sweat a lot."

McGorry famously had a shirtless scene in season 1, where the former bodybuilder got to show off his physique. When asked if fans could look forward to such exposing scenes again in season 2, McGorry was hesitant to say anything.

"I don't know if I could give any of that away," McGorry said. "I don't know if I can tell you any of that."

Buzz about the second season of Orange is the New Black is intensifying now that Netflix has announced the premiere date.

Enstars was first to report on the season 2 premiere date that appeared at the end of the season 2 finale of House of Cards. Orange is the New Black season 2 premieres in full on Friday, June 6 only on Netflix streaming.

The season will be 13 episodes, just like the first season.
